Using AI Workout Prompts for Custom Routines

AI workout prompts interface showing customizable fitness parameters

AI workout prompts transform general fitness goals into specific training programs. These prompts function as detailed instructions that tell AI tools exactly what type of workout plan you need. The quality of your prompts directly impacts the usefulness of generated routines.

Effective prompts include specific details about your fitness goals, current level, and constraints. Instead of asking for a generic workout, you specify target muscle groups, preferred training style, session duration, and available equipment. This precision helps AI create routines that match your exact needs.

Essential Elements of Effective Fitness Prompts

Start every prompt by clearly stating your primary goal. Are you building muscle, losing fat, improving strength, or training for athletic performance? The AI adjusts exercise selection and rep ranges based on this objective.

Include your experience level to ensure appropriate exercise complexity. Beginners need fundamental movement patterns with lower intensity. Advanced trainees benefit from complex exercises and higher training volume. Matching difficulty to your level prevents injury and maximizes results.

Sample AI Fitness Prompts That Work

A strength-focused prompt might read: “Create a four-day upper-lower split for intermediate lifter with three years experience. Goal is building muscle and increasing strength in bench press, squat, and deadlift. Access to full gym equipment. Sessions should last 60-75 minutes with emphasis on compound movements.”

For home training: “Generate a three-day full-body workout plan for beginner using only resistance bands and adjustable dumbbells up to 50 pounds. Goal is losing fat while maintaining muscle. Each workout should take 45 minutes and include warm-up and cool-down.”

Optimizing Prompts for Different Goals

Muscle building prompts emphasize progressive overload and volume. Specify desired rep ranges between six and twelve for hypertrophy. Request exercise variety targeting muscle groups from multiple angles. Include instructions for tracking weights and progressive increases.

Fat loss prompts focus on workout density and metabolic stress. Ask for circuit-style training or supersets that maintain elevated heart rate. Request shorter rest periods and exercises engaging multiple muscle groups. Specify calorie-burning activities alongside strength work.

Creating Personalized Workout Plans With AI

AI analyzing fitness data to create personalized workout plan

Building a complete workout plan requires more than random exercise selection. AI tools structure your training by organizing exercises into logical sessions and weekly schedules. This systematic approach ensures balanced development across all muscle groups while managing fatigue and recovery.

The planning process starts with establishing your training frequency. Beginners thrive on three full-body sessions weekly. Intermediate and advanced trainees benefit from four to six sessions using split routines that target specific muscle groups each day.

Structuring Your Weekly Training Split

AI determines optimal training splits based on your schedule and recovery capacity. Common splits include push-pull-legs, upper-lower, and body-part splits. Each approach offers distinct advantages for different experience levels and goals.

The system balances training volume across the week. It prevents overlapping muscle groups on consecutive days that could hinder recovery. Rest days get positioned strategically to maximize adaptation and minimize injury risk.

Training Split Weekly Frequency Best For Experience Level
Full Body 3 days Overall fitness, fat loss, beginners Beginner to Intermediate
Upper Lower 4 days Balanced muscle building, strength gains Intermediate
Push Pull Legs 6 days Maximum muscle growth, high volume Advanced
Body Part Split 5-6 days Bodybuilding, muscle isolation Advanced

Exercise Selection and Progression

AI prioritizes compound movements that build overall strength and muscle. Exercises like squats, deadlifts, bench press, and rows form the foundation. The system adds isolation exercises to target specific muscle groups and address weaknesses.

Progression schemes follow proven principles that drive adaptation. AI implements progressive overload by gradually increasing weight, reps, or sets over time. The system tracks your performance and recommends appropriate increases based on your progress rate.

Adjusting Plans Based on Equipment

Home gym setups require different exercise selections than commercial facilities. AI adapts recommendations based on available equipment. Dumbbells substitute for barbells when needed. Resistance bands replace cable machines. Bodyweight variations fill gaps when equipment limitations exist.

The system maintains training effectiveness regardless of equipment constraints. It focuses on movement patterns rather than specific machines. This flexibility ensures consistent progress whether you train at home or in a fully equipped gym.

Optimizing Training Intensity and Volume

Managing training intensity separates effective programs from wasted effort. AI tools calculate optimal load based on your capabilities and recovery status. The system balances challenging workouts with adequate recovery to maximize adaptation without overtraining.

Training volume refers to total work performed across exercises, sets, and reps. AI determines appropriate volume for your experience level and goals. Beginners need less volume to stimulate growth. Advanced trainees require higher volume to continue progressing.

Understanding Intensity Levels

Intensity measures how hard you work during exercises. For strength training, intensity relates to weight lifted as a percentage of your one-rep max. Cardiovascular intensity uses heart rate zones. AI prescribes specific intensity levels for each workout based on your goals and training phase.

The system cycles intensity throughout your training week. Heavy days with maximum weights alternate with moderate and light sessions. This variation prevents burnout while allowing adequate recovery between high-stress workouts.

Adjusting Volume for Progress

AI tracks your volume tolerance through performance data. It increases total sets and reps gradually as you adapt. This progressive volume approach builds capacity over months and years. The system prevents sudden jumps that could trigger overuse injuries.

Recovery capacity limits how much volume you can handle. Factors like sleep quality, nutrition, stress, and age impact recovery. AI considers these variables when prescribing weekly volume. It reduces training load during high-stress periods and increases volume when conditions support aggressive training.

Creating Your Implementation Plan

Dedicate your first week to setup and baseline establishment. Input your current fitness level, goals, and preferences into your chosen AI tools. Complete initial assessments that measure strength levels and movement patterns. This foundation enables accurate personalization.

Week two focuses on habit establishment. Follow AI-generated workout routines exactly as prescribed. Track every session and all relevant habits. The system needs consistent data to provide useful insights and recommendations.

  • Complete initial fitness assessment and goal setting in your AI platform
  • Generate your first month of personalized workout routines using AI prompts
  • Set up habit tracking for sleep, nutrition, hydration, and training consistency
  • Perform baseline measurements for body composition and key lifts
  • Execute your first week of training exactly as prescribed by AI
  • Log all workouts with weights, reps, and subjective difficulty ratings
  • Review weekly progress and AI-generated insights after week one
  • Make minor adjustments based on initial feedback and recovery
  • Continue consistent tracking through first month for pattern establishment
  • Evaluate monthly progress and allow AI to adjust programming for month two

Troubleshooting Common Issues

Inconsistent tracking creates gaps in AI recommendations. Make logging workouts non-negotiable. Set reminders immediately after training when details remain fresh. Incomplete data leads to generic suggestions that ignore your specific patterns.

Overly ambitious goals produce unsustainable programs. Be honest about your available time and current fitness level. AI generates realistic plans when given accurate information. Unrealistic inputs create programs you cannot maintain long-term.
